genealogic

The genealogic chart shows our family's history.

Definition
  1. Adjective:
    • Relating to genealogy: Pertaining to the study and tracing of lines of descent or family history.
    • Concerning family lineage: Involving or describing the record or investigation of ancestry and pedigrees.
Examples of Usage
  • Adjective:
    • The library has a vast collection of genealogic charts and documents.
    • Her research is purely genealogic, focusing on the migration patterns of her ancestors.
Advanced Usage
  • "genealogic tree": A diagram showing the relationships between individuals across generations in a family.
    • He spent years constructing a detailed genealogic tree for his clan.
Variants and Related Words
  • Genealogical (adj): The more common variant, identical in meaning to 'genealogic'.
    • She is conducting genealogical research.
  • Genealogy (n): The study of family ancestries and histories.
    • He became interested in genealogy later in life.
  • Genealogist (n): A person who studies or traces family lineages.
    • The genealogist helped them find records from the 18th century.
Synonyms
  • Ancestral: Pertaining to ancestors or family heritage.
  • Lineal: Relating to direct descent in a line from an ancestor.
Notes on Usage
  • The adjective genealogic is synonymous with genealogical. While genealogical is the more frequently used form in modern English, genealogic is also correct and is often found in academic or formal texts related to the field of genealogy.
